Dogecoin Consolidates: Is DOGE Preparing a Bear Trap for $0.20?

News RoomBy News Room6 hours ago0 ViewsNo Comments3 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est Telegram Email Tumblr Reddit LinkedIn

Analyzing Dogecoin’s Market Movements: Are We on the Cusp of a Breakout?

Dogecoin (DOGE) has recently entered a fascinating phase, characterized by a tight trading range between $0.14 and $0.17. This consolidation period is reminiscent of earlier phases that prefaced sharper price movements in the cryptocurrency market. Historically, such configurations are often the calm before a significant volatility breakout, prompting traders and analysts to keenly observe DOGE’s next potential directional move. After returning to a pivotal support zone last tested in April, DOGE appears to be gearing up for another attempt to breach the 20-cent mark, contingent on a resurgence of bullish momentum.

However, it is essential to treat this bullish potential with caution. Since peaking at approximately $0.25 back in May, DOGE has suffered three unsuccessful breakout attempts, each culminating in substantial liquidations for long positions, which indicates a market struggling with buyer strength. This recent dip to $0.14 represents the fourth consecutive lower low seen over a 60-day timeline, reinforcing a bearish market structure. Therefore, while hope for a rally exists, market participants must recognize the fragility of the current setup.

Examining the derivatives landscape offers further insights. The DOGE/USDT perpetuals on Binance reflect a considerable long dominance at around 75%, which signifies strong conviction among traders. However, this skewed positioning may pose risks, as a tightly clustered group of long positions heightens chances for a liquidity sweep—where overextended buyers are forced to close positions en masse during a price drop. In contrast, if robust on-chain demand sustains this leveraged positioning, it could indicate that DOGE’s current consolidation phase reflects strategic accumulation rather than mere indecision.

Interestingly, the recent price behaviors of DOGE reveal deeper market dynamics at play. The 32% decline from its early-May high is not merely a technical correction; rather, it marks a comprehensive leverage flush, where long positions were liquidated at unprecedented rates—peaking at 96.29%. This massive liquidation may have created an environment where the potential for a price recovery exists post-flush, rather than signaling further declines. As liquidation dominance trends downward to just 6.14%, the lowest observed this month, it suggests that the most strenuous phase of liquidation may be behind us.

A comparison with previous price data elucidates this shift further. Following an extreme spike in liquidation dominance on June 21, where it soared to 97.56%, DOGE did not experience the same downward momentum it had seen earlier in May. This resilience in the face of liquidation indicates that the underlying market structure may be stabilizing, hinting at a potentially more sustainable phase for DOGE. With the current long bias possibly signaling a strategic accumulation phase instead of impulsive trading decisions, savvy investors may find ripe opportunities as late shorts become vulnerable.

Looking forward, the current landscape for Dogecoin presents both opportunities and challenges. If the bullish momentum can be rekindled, it may indeed scaffold a classic bear trap scenario, catching late-market shorts unaware and accelerating upward movement towards the targeted $0.20 level. Hence, all eyes should remain on the evolving dynamics of both price action and trading sentiment as traders navigate this precarious yet intriguing phase in Dogecoin’s storied journey.
